Job Summary:

SUMMARY

The Revenue Management & Operations team is seeking a Senior Manager, Terms Compliance Management who will be an outstanding addition to our team. As a Senior Manager, Terms Compliance Management at Hulu, you will focus your attention in three key areas: terms and conditions negotiation, terms and condition implementation and compliance management.

WHAT YOU'LL DO

* Support Sales leads in the negotiation of T&Cs with agency/advertiser leads
* Consult with P&P vertical leads in streamlining agency-wide business T&Cs across all DAS brands & business verticals to develop a deep understanding of opening position and fall back positions in negotiation
* Coordinate with internal teams, including Ad Operations, Research and Marketing, to push key business targets/process requirements into annual agreements
* Coordinate and consult with Ad Sales Legal, Collections, and Corporate Privacy teams to address any inconsistencies between business terms & governance terms, and ensure that all terms are executed and agreed upon
* Address client-specific terms, including benefits or special exceptions, that may differ from the broader agency partnership
* Document and report status of terms negotiation and agreement, track deliverables, and hold various relevant parties accountable for delivery
* Develop and maintain company standard terms for use in cases where agency/advertiser terms dont apply or exist
* Lead P&P efforts in templating, synergizing, and updating agency/vertical ratecards around T&Cs
* Educate Sales, P&P, and Operations teams around annual T&Cs agreements and strategy
* Summarize T&Cs agreements on key points across the organization and serve as the advisor to all terms questions assessing impact from proposed business or technology changes
* Partner with P&Ps Execution & Development team to surface operational gaps as it relates to T&Cs implementation & compliance that may require additional training efforts with current/new hires
* Collaborate with Sales and P&P leads to ensure agency/client parameters are accurately implemented into SalesForce/SalesHub/Operative
* Partner with Ad Product, Analytics & Business Enablement in driving system improvements that will improve the accuracy & efficiency of terms reporting
* Monitor trends in digital advertising and proactively incorporate new concepts into agreements with advertisers
* Supervise the end to end IO workflow and approvals process to identify gaps or inefficiencies
* Handle our third party MediaMint relationship in order to drive the efficiency of the IO review process
* Lead resolution of all MediaMint exception escalations as it relates to terms and ensure other escalations are routed appropriately through the organization
* Serve as primary point of contact for P&P during Audits, and Operate as the Control Owner for all P&P controls related to IOs, Terms, and Ratecards ensuring compliance for all audits (Management Audits, SOX Audits, etc.), in partnership with Ad Sales Finance

The Walt Disney Company, commonly known as Walt Disney or simply Disney, is an American diversified multinational mass media and entertainment conglomerate headquartered at the Walt Disney Studios in Burbank, California.

Disney was originally founded on October 16, 1923 by brothers Walt and Roy O. Disney as the Disney Brothers Cartoon Studio; it also operated under the names The Walt Disney Studio and Walt Disney Productions before officially changing its name to The Walt Disney Company in 1986. The company established itself as a leader in the American animation industry before diversifying into live-action film production, television, and theme parks.

Since the 1980s, Disney has created and acquired corporate divisions in order to market more mature content than is typically associated with its flagship family-oriented brands. The company is known for its film studio division, Walt Disney Studios, which includes Walt Disney Pictures, Walt Disney Animation Studios, Pixar, Marvel Studios, Lucasfilm, 20th Century Fox, Fox Searchlight Pictures, and Blue Sky Studios. Disney's other main divisions are Disney Parks, Experiences and Products, Disney Media Networks, and Walt Disney Direct-to-Consumer & International. Disney also owns and operates the ABC broadcast network; cable television networks such as Disney Channel, ESPN, Freeform, FX, National Geographic Network, and A&E Networks; publishing, merchandising, music, and theater divisions; and Walt Disney Parks and Resorts, a group of 14 theme parks around the world.

The company has been a component of the Dow Jones Industrial Average since 1991. Cartoon character Mickey Mouse, created in 1928 by Walt Disney and Ub Iwerks, is one of the world's most recognizable characters, and serves as the company's official mascot.
